    There are a number of devices that my 5796 won't power through the USB ports, one is a USB powered scanner and now my new Blackberry won't run. Anyone else have USB power issues?

    there is no power issues from the M570TU that I had a chance to test.

    the USB port can only power a single USB-powerable device (up to 5v) like HDDs, some kinds of MP3 players, etc..

    You must also realize that its not each port that can do it, but a set of ports is connected by a USB hub....
    - so on the M570TU you can really only power 2 major USB-powerable devices
    - one on the side USB section, one on the back USB section.

    As for minor USB devices like Mice and such, you can do one per port easily.
